Sudna Population - Murshidabad, West Bengal

Sudna is a medium size village located in Farakka Block of Murshidabad district, West Bengal with total 79 families residing. The Sudna village has population of 335 of which 163 are males while 172 are females as per Population Census 2011.

In Sudna village population of children with age 0-6 is 35 which makes up 10.45 % of total population of village. Average Sex Ratio of Sudna village is 1055 which is higher than West Bengal state average of 950. Child Sex Ratio for the Sudna as per census is 1188, higher than West Bengal average of 956.

Sudna village has lower literacy rate compared to West Bengal. In 2011, literacy rate of Sudna village was 66.00 % compared to 76.26 % of West Bengal. In Sudna Male literacy stands at 74.15 % while female literacy rate was 58.17 %.

Caste Factor

Schedule Caste (SC) constitutes 2.09 % of total population in Sudna village. The village Sudna currently doesn’t have any Schedule Tribe (ST) population.

Work Profile

In Sudna village out of total population, 102 were engaged in work activities. 62.75 % of workers describe their work as Main Work (Employment or Earning more than 6 Months) while 37.25 % were involved in Marginal activity providing livelihood for less than 6 months. Of 102 workers engaged in Main Work, 16 were cultivators (owner or co-owner) while 1 were Agricultural labourer.
